Abstract
The new iridoid glycosides, 4-deoxykanoko side A and 4'-deoxykanokoside C, were isolated from the methanolic root extract of Centranthus long florus ssp. longiflorus. They were accompanied by the three known iridoid glycosides, kanokoside A, kanokoside C and valerosidatum, and two known phenylpropanoid glycosides, coniferin and isoconiferinoside. The structures were elucidated mainly by spectroscopic methods. The presence of 4-deoxy glucose as a part of plant glycosides is rather unusual. Cytotoxic effects of the isolated compounds were also investigated. (C) 2002 Elsevier Science Ltd. All rights reserved.
